Patient Lead Leakage Current Tests (Patient Modules)
Before you can perform the Patient Lead Leakage Current Test, verify that the monitor passes the
ground resistance and chassis current leakage tests. It is recommended that the equipment be
operating for 30 minutes prior to the test to allow thermal stabilization. If a 12-lead patient cable is
used with the module being tested, perform the tests using the 12-lead cable.
1. Patient Leads Current Leakage — measure the leakage current between each of the patient
leadwires and the ground lug on the monitor back panel. Also, measure the leakage current
between all combinations of ECG leads and ground. The current must be less than 10
µA
with the ground connected, and 50 µA with the ground open.
2. Leakage Current to Ground with 50/60 Hz — AC mains voltage applied to leads. Apply AC
mains voltage and measure the leakage current between each of the ECG leadwires and
the ground lug on the monitor back panel. The current must be less than 50 µA at any line
voltage.
Monitor Functional Tests
This procedure verifies operation of the Ethernet port, patient data logger, remote alarm, and
external SDLC options. It assumes that a multi-parameter module, either 90470 or 90496, is
available for testing purposes. In the event that these modules are not available, similar modules
may be substituted for verifying specific parameters.
Required Tools/Test Equipment
Waveform simulator and appropriate patient cable.
If patient data logger option is to be tested: terminal or computer with VT100 emulator and
appropriate standard PC cable to connect it to the properly configured DB9 serial port on the
monitor.
Module housing (for 90385).
